Drupal Camp Asheville 2022

Drupal Camp Asheville 2024 - July 12th-14th




700 Founders Drive
Asheville NC 28804
Get Directions

35.6144704, -82.5689299

Event Sessions

Creating a Custom Packagist

Allan Chappell
Four Kitchens
The goal of this article is to give you some ideas on how to host a solid packagist for a team, organization, or client while describing how the Four Kitchens team came up with a fun and creative solution to provide this functionality using the tools our client had on hand

Demystifying Git - Version Control From First Principles

Dwayne McDaniel
This session will peel back the shroud of mystery that envelops Git, showing that there is nothing overly complex or terrifying about the inner workings of the world's most popular version control system. This talk is for everyone, from the complete Git novice to folks who have been pushing code for years but maybe have never stopped to look at how Git does its thing.

Event Management with Drupal and Commerce

Rich Gerdes
Unleashed Technologies
The event registration module is designed to handle not only individual attendees, but also speakers, sponsors, and supporting persons and organizations. Through the extensibility of Drupal Commerce and entities, these modules can provide a solution for almost any event situation. 

Finding Purpose and Alignment in Your Career

Chris McGrath
Dori Kelner
In this session, Chris McGrath, CEO and Dori Kelner, V.P. of Culture + Well-being at Esteemed will share insights and reflections for mastering self-awareness and connecting with our authentic selves. They will discuss the themes and patterns encountered while working the past 25+ years with developers of all backgrounds

Google Analytics 4: Upgrade Before It's Too Late!

Stephen Pashby
Google has announced the end of support for Universal Analytics in July 2023. Don't wait until your Google Analytics stops working to implement Google Analytics 4! We will review the differences between Universal Analytics and Google Analytics 4, how to best plan your transition and configure equivalent (or better) tracking in Google Analytics 4, and common ways to easily implement Google Analytics 4 in Drupal.

I am Functional and So Can You

JD Flynn
This session is geared towards individuals who are having difficulties dealing with mental illness diagnosis, people who are curious about getting past the stigma associated with mental illness, or people who are curious and would like to learn more about being a better friend to those who live with mental illness.

Raffle, Lightning Talks, and Closing

We will start by giving some prizes away and then Lightning Talks.

Anyone can present a lightning talk and it can be about any topic. Each speaker gets 5 minutes to talk about their topic, slides or no slides.

If you want to speak, sign up during the prize raffle.


Security in Drupal: what can go wrong?

Benji Fisher
Let's "get off the island" and look at Drupal security from the point of view of an outsider. The OWASP Top Ten is an industry standard list of the most common vulnerabilities that can affect web sites. This session will start with an overview of the Top Ten, and then take a more detailed look at a few of these vulnerabilities. We will review some actual Drupal security advisories:

You don't have to be a technical writer to write technically

Marjorie Freeman
Red Hat Inc.

A technical writer is a professional who translates highly technical concepts into a digestible format for the end-user. A huge part of a technologist's role -- no matter an architect, developer, or sysadmin -- is communication. But everyone has different ways of doing so.